Just another newb here in need of a little help....and probably some 
sleep as well ;) I'm just getting started with PHP reading all I can 
get my hands on, on and off line. I have simple bit of code that 
displays a list of mp3 files from a different directory from which the 
script runs in..... 
 
<table align=CENTER bgcolor=#ffffff cellpadding=4 cellspacing=0 
border=2> 
<tr><th>Song Title</th></tr> 
<?php 
$dir = "../songs/"; 
 
// Open a known directory, and proceed to read its contents 
if (is_dir($dir)) { 
   if ($dh = opendir($dir)) { 
       while (($file = readdir($dh)) !== false) { 
           echo "<tr><td> <a href=\"$dir\">$file</a>  "."</td></tr>"; 
       } 
       closedir($dh); 
   } 
} 
?> 
 
the display is fine, I'm just pulling my hair out trying to get the 
link to the individual files set correctly, but alas everything I've 
tried so far bombs out. I do not know how to add the file name along 
with the directory in the href ;(
